The influence of thin gold film surface nanostructure on H-2 chemisorption
on unsintered gold films at 78 K was studied. Three classes of thin Au film
s of different thicknesses were chosen for these experiments, as follows: (
i) very thin, purplish colour, transparent film formed by isolated Au islan
ds, (ii) violet-green colour film formed by Au islands joined together and
creating a kind of golden net, (iii) non-transparent, continuous Au film of
golden colour. It has been found that H-2 chemisorption occurs only in the
case when the thin Au films are deposited at low temperatures (78 K) and u
nsintered. It has been suggested that this chemisorption occurs on surface
Au atoms of low coordination number as a result of formation of AuH2 comple
xes, similarly to the compounds arising due to H-2 interaction with isolate
d Au atoms. (C) 1999 Elsevier Science B.V. All rights reserved.
